Samsung just dropped a tiny AI model that outsmarts models 10,000× bigger, yes, even Gemini and o3-mini. And Harvard’s AI doctor just made medical history. This episode’s full of jaw-dropping breakthroughs.
We’ll talk about:
- How Samsung’s TRM model crushes logic benchmarks with just 7M parameters
- Why recursion might replace scale in the next wave of AI
- Harvard’s “Dr. CaBot” becomes the first AI published in NEJM, going head-to-head with a human doctor
- What these updates say about the future of reasoning, AI tools, and the myth of bigger always being better
